Transaction e21e6cbe76140e5bd97586e6581425efa8eb0dd8ec9aa44fe2e980c06bf55efc
1 Input
1 Output
-
e21e6cbe76140e5bd97586e6581425efa8eb0dd8ec9aa44fe2e980c06bf55efc:0
- value
- 531228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a1d6f13687ea026d88249106083a4b4bf7bdf83 OP_EQUAL
- address
- 38SuBqmpruuzUMGbn24aZ4mTdE2APEW6vB